How Quick Recap (Active Recall) Strengthens Memory
Quick Recap, also known as Active Recall, involves actively stimulating your memory during study sessions.
Instead of passively reading or listening, you try to recall information from memory. This practice strengthens neural connections and improves long-term retention.
For example, instead of just reading a textbook, you might ask yourself questions about the material and answer them without looking — forcing your brain to work harder while solidifying the information in memory.

Why Spaced Repetition Boosts Long-Term Learning
Spaced repetition involves reviewing information at increasing intervals over time. It helps counter the forgetting curve, a concept introduced by Hermann Ebbinghaus, which shows how quickly we forget information after learning it.
By spacing reviews, students reinforce the material just as it begins to fade, maintaining it more effectively in long-term memory.
According to Benjamin, here are several ways to apply spaced repetition in your study routine:
- Using flashcards
- Quizzes
- Lesson starters (short questions before lessons)
- Homework exercises
- Regular testing
- Interleaving (combining multiple topics into one question)
